How much do remote construction manager jobs pay per year?

As of May 28,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ote construction manager in Columbus, OH is $98,048.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$63,300.00 and $129,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Construction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Construction Manager, you need strong project management skills, construction knowledge, and typically a degree in construction management or a related field. Proficiency with construction management software like Procore, MS Project, and remote collaboration tools is essential, along with certifications such as PMP or OSHA safety credentials. Excellent communication, leadership, and problem-solving skills are crucial for coordinating dispersed teams and stakeholders. These abilities ensure projects are completed on time, within budget, and to quality standards, even when managed from a distance.

How do Remote Construction Managers effectively oversee projects and maintain communication with on-site teams?

Remote Construction Managers rely heavily on digital tools and regular virtual meetings to monitor project progress and address issues promptly. They utilize project management software, video conferencing, and real-time reporting to stay connected with on-site supervisors and contractors. Establishing clear communication protocols and setting expectations for updates helps ensure alignment across the team. While physical site visits may be less frequent, strong organizational and leadership skills are essential to successfully manage timelines, budgets, and quality from a distance.

What does a Remote Construction Manager do?

A Remote Construction Manager oversees construction projects from a remote location, using digital tools and technology to communicate with on-site teams, monitor progress, and ensure that projects stay on schedule and within budget. They coordinate with contractors, clients, and suppliers, resolve issues as they arise, and ensure compliance with safety and quality standards. This role is ideal for managing multiple projects across different locations without being physically present at each site, thanks to advances in project management software and virtual communication platforms.

What is the difference between Remote Construction Manager vs Remote Project Coordinator?

AspectRemote Construction ManagerRemote Project Coordinator
CredentialsConstruction management degree, certifications like PMP or CCMProject management or related degree, certifications like CAPM or PMP
Work EnvironmentOversees multiple projects, manages teams remotely, liaises with clients and contractorsSupports project teams, handles scheduling, documentation, and communication remotely
Industry UsageUsed across construction firms, real estate developers, and infrastructure companiesCommon in construction, engineering, and architecture firms

The Remote Construction Manager focuses on overseeing entire construction projects, managing teams, and ensuring project completion. In contrast, the Remote Project Coordinator handles supporting tasks like scheduling, documentation, and communication to facilitate project progress. Both roles require strong organizational skills and industry knowledge but differ in scope and responsibilities.
